> Using the option --strict we get a check hint that the broken line
> of the regmap_clear_bits() is not aligned. We tried but were not
> able to make the tool happy. This matches our experience with this
> check hint and previous patches.

Lining up the first char of the broken line with the open parenthesis
will make checkpatch happy. It's easier if you configure your editor
to always do this, rather than with strict tabs.
